Output ea54da85785bdf68ceb6816be3fcd22abbcef36b5fa344a87ac977e8e317d601:2

value
434391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 221c1dd528be675497efb36497c124c23cd3db22 OP_EQUAL
address
34oNadu8xyaM9ad7JTSXyWPBizPCyA63rS
transaction
ea54da85785bdf68ceb6816be3fcd22abbcef36b5fa344a87ac977e8e317d601
spent
true